CSS显示:无/阻止在FORM

时间:2018-05-25 15:34:29

标签: html css

仍在使用纯CSS语言切换器。

带有display: none/blockdiv的CSS span不能在HTML FORM内工作吗?

以下是代码:



.tab {display:none}

.default-tab {display:block}

:target ~ .default-tab {display:none}

#eng:target ~ .eng,
#deu:target ~ .deu {
  display: block
}

<a href="#eng"><img src="http://icons.iconarchive.com/icons/custom-icon-design/flat-europe-flag/48/United-Kingdom-icon.png"></a>


<a href="#deu"><img src="http://icons.iconarchive.com/icons/custom-icon-design/flat-europe-flag/48/Germany-icon.png"></a>

<a id="eng"></a>
<a id="deu"></a>

<div class="tab eng default-tab">Some English content</div>
<div class="tab deu">Was auf deutsch.</div><p>



<form>
  <input type="radio" name="gender" value="male" checked>
  <div class="tab eng default-tab">Male</div>
  <div class="tab deu">M&auml;nnlich</div>
  <br>
  <input type="radio" name="gender" value="female">
  <div class="tab eng default-tab">Female</div>
  <div class="tab deu">Weiblich</div>
</form> 

<hr>
  <div class="tab eng default-tab">Male</div>
  <div class="tab deu">M&auml;nnlich</div>
&#13;
&#13;
&#13;

完全在表格之外工作,但不在里面。

1 个答案:

答案 0 :(得分:0)

UPDATE Table SET Value = Left(Value, 3) + Mid(Value, 3) + "-" WHERE Field = "Phone" 中的~选择器表示&#34; a ~ b&#34;的所有兄弟姐妹。

您可能希望影响b,即使他们不是兄弟姐妹,也不想影响兄弟姐妹的孩子(在您的情况下是b的孩子),因此您必须向现有form添加a ~ * b选择器:

a ~ * b,
a ~ b {}
相关问题